Writing beyond the Curriculum: Transition, Transfer, and Transformation
Lettner-Rust, Heather G.; Tracy, Pamela J.; Booker, Susan L.; Kocevar-Weidinger, Elizabeth; Burges, Jená B.
Across the Disciplines, v4 Oct 2007
The authors describe how their institution revised its general education writing curriculum and how that change not only affected the university's approach to advanced composition but also transformed the roles and relationships among teachers, librarians, literacy practices, curricula, students, and the community. Part service-learning, part civic engagement, part student-directed research, and part interdisciplinary senior seminar, the course at the heart of the change combines a variation of writing-as-process with a substantial shift in writing-across-thecurriculum practices. The authors outline the course's establishment, discuss what various constituents have experienced, and argue for the transformation of higher education's mission from an instructional paradigm to a learning paradigm.
